Ending after fallout 2 Not long after the destruction of the Enclave, the Bishop Family of New Reno was blessed with a child. This child seemed to have little in common with the Bishops, preferring instead to spend his days exploring the wastes. When he turned thirteen, he seized control of the Bishop Family and led them to victory over the remaining New Reno families. He died quietly in his sleep at the age of seventy-three, never having known his real father

If you can't get out of there, you can always just attempt to assassinate him, which you can do through the safe in his room. With high repair, you can change the lock on the safe, which will trigger the trap and kill Bishop when he tries to open it. With high traps, you can set your own explosive and wait for him to open it that way. This may require dialogue with Mrs. Bishop, though. Not exactly sure.
